Henrick Hanson Went to New-
ca.tle last Friday wi.th the mail
carrisr and is taking treatments
from the chiropractor.
Clyde Gibbs and his mother, Mrs.
A. J. Gibbs, hve pen: he past
week iR Newcastle. Clyde is suf-
fering with inflamatory rheuma-
tism. His mother went in to take
cre of him.
Harold Swift of Rapid City stay-
ed al night at Hnson's, Thuviy.
Rev. Jesse Ricel and wife of
Torrington held church services in
the home of Henrick Hanson last
Fxiday night instead uf tt the A. J.
Gibbs home, due to Clyde Gibb's
llness.
They interior to hold services a¢
A. J. Gibb's home h'tdy night,
November 15.
